Transaction f2420d29a2d42daf95f2baadefa17fbcc1455605a688b501d8ab1562d4e19b8d
1 Input
2 Outputs
- f2420d29a2d42daf95f2baadefa17fbcc1455605a688b501d8ab1562d4e19b8d:0
- f2420d29a2d42daf95f2baadefa17fbcc1455605a688b501d8ab1562d4e19b8d:1
value 225198
address 3HwsSSmR65HP72f2xgxVZs7uoEhezvZzao
value 19281352
address 18dGYJahpP7hwVxieHGTWxUuWH1H3bSHGU